Underrated Audio aims to provide you with some dope looks from the last seven days that flew under most peoples' radars. While they may have received front-page placement on HNHH, they didn't get as many views as they deserve, so we shine a little more light on them right here.

In this week's edition, we look at music from Chicago's buzzing Alex Wiley, Detroit's JMSN, South Central rapper and Dreamville signee Cozz, as well as the always-unique Theophilus London.
